Science for the Public: Using Gravitational Lensing to Detect Dark Matter , January 14th, 2025. Recorded live at the Beech Street Center, Belmont MA. Guest: Jacqueline McCleary, Ph.D., Assistant Professor of Physics, Northeastern University. Dark matter accounts for some 27 percent of the universe but is invisible. One promising technique to reveal it is the analysis of gravitational lensing that very occasionally aligns galaxy clusters. The much-noted “cosmic question mark” image for this event is the result of a rare alignment between two distant galaxies due to gravitational lensing. Professor Jacqueline McCleary explains how cosmologists use such examples of weak gravitational lensing between galaxy clusters to explore the nature of elusive dark matter and its interaction with galaxies. She discusses how cosmologists gather and analyze data from observatories on mountaintops, in the stratosphere, and in space. 00:42:16
